Skysong, Inc. receives a $9500, 6-month, 6% promissory note from Sheridan Company in settlement of an open accounts receivable. What entry will Skysong, Inc. make upon receiving the note?

1 Answer

2 votes

Answer:

the journal entry should be:

Dr Notes receivable 9,500

Cr Accounts receivable 9,500

Step-by-step explanation:

Since Sheridan Company owed money to Skysong ($9,500), Skysong recorded that amount as an account receivable. Since the note receivable replaces the account receivable, the accounts receivable must be credited (assets decrease when credited).

If note is collected on time, the journal entry should be:

Dr Cash 9,785

Cr Notes receivable 9,500

Cr interest revenue 285
